What chemicals are the major causes of ozone depletion in the stratosphere?

chlorofluorocarbons (CFCs), hydrochlorofluorcarbons (HCFCs), carbon tetrachloride and methyl chloroform

Halons are the worst offenders because they are exponentially more caustic in nature than the other substances.
